Inaugurating it after a meeting of the Library Committee of the party attended by leaders including party's National General Secretary (Organisation) Ram Lal, Shah said that the library should not only present the nationalist ideology family but all the social-political traditions of the country.
"There will be arrangement to maintain records of all political parties and movements of the country," he said.
While the inauguration of the library and archive took place in the central office of the party, this is not limited to here and such library and archives will be opened across the country.
Noting that library and archives have always been given importance in BJP and Jana Sangh, it noted that keeping in mind the extended activities of the party and changing times, there is a need to reorganize it and technically restructure it as per the digital age.
"The party will take it up as a campaign," the statement said.
